菜鸟教程小白 发表于 2022-12-11 18:33:37

ios - 是否可以将带有大框架的uiview添加到带有小框架的uiview中


                                            <p><p>在我的应用程序中,我需要在另一个 View 中添加 subview ,但我的问题是父 View 的高度和宽度为 50*50, subview 的高度为 150*150,那么我该如何添加呢?因为当我添加这个 View 时, subview 的其余部分被裁剪了。</p></p>
                                    <br><hr><h1><strong>Best Answer-推荐答案</ strong></h1><br>
                                            <p><p>边缘在较小的 UIView 中是有界的。因为 UIView 较小,它会裁剪出较大的 subview 。如果您仍然希望 superView 为 50x50 并且不希望裁剪掉较大的 subview ,请关闭 UIView 的 <code>setClipsToBound</code> 属性:</p>

<p> swift :<code>view.setClipsToBound = false</code>
Objective-C: <code>;</code></p>

<p>另一种解决方案就是将 subview 变小或将包含大 subview 的父 View 变大。</p></p>
                                   
                                                <p style="font-size: 20px;">关于ios - 是否可以将带有大框架的uiview添加到带有小框架的uiview中,我们在Stack Overflow上找到一个类似的问题:
                                                        <a href="https://stackoverflow.com/questions/41592496/" rel="noreferrer noopener nofollow" style="color: red;">
                                                                https://stackoverflow.com/questions/41592496/
                                                        </a>
                                                </p>
                                       
页: [1]
查看完整版本: ios - 是否可以将带有大框架的uiview添加到带有小框架的uiview中